About this House

Affordable in Starkville! 3 BD / 1.5 BA home in a quiet cul-de-sac. Easy access to Hwy 82 and 25 bypass. Minutes from downtown Starkville, Oktibbeha Co Hospital, and MS State Univesity.
512 Inca Dr, Starkville, MS 39759 is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om, 1,082 sqft single-family home built in 1984. This property is not currently displayed as for sale or rent on Trulia. The Trulia Estimate is $166,500, with a rent estimate of $1,506/month.
